Dismissed officials of Islami Bank staged a protest on the Chattogram–Cox’s Bazar Highway at the Crossing area of Karnaphuli upazila in Chattogram on Tuesday (September 30). The demonstration, which took place from 12:00 pm to 1:00 pm, brought traffic to a halt for nearly an hour. However, protesters allowed ambulances and emergency vehicles to pass.

During the protest, the terminated officials labeled those who participated in the bank’s special assessment examination as “munafiq” (hypocrites) and later hurled eggs at their photographs in an expression of anger.

The demonstrators announced that if their demands are not met during the Durga Puja holidays, they will launch a full-scale blockade from next Sunday.

Currently, around 5,500 officials of Islami Bank in the Chattogram region are facing uncertainty. Discontent has escalated after the bank organized a controversial “competency assessment test,” allegedly in defiance of a court order. The dismissed officials collectively rejected the exam. So far, 200 officials have been terminated, while 4,953 others have been made OSD (Officer on Special Duty). In protest, the dismissed officials have put forward six demands.

Key Demands of the Protesters:

1. Immediate reinstatement of officials dismissed without valid reason.

2. Return of transferred officials to nearby branches instead of distant postings.

3. Investigation into irregular promotions made during the previous government.

4. Assurance of a discrimination-free and politically neutral working environment.

5. Cancellation of all types of assessment tests.

6. Investigation into the mental and physical harassment of Chattogram officials, with punitive action against those responsible.

The protesters stressed that unless all officials in Greater Chattogram are reinstated promptly, they will intensify their movement.
